'HAHAHA' - schadenfreude sweeps web after German downfall

The internet turned cruel for Germany fans on Thursday as online mockery swept the globe following the defending champions' shock World Cup elimination.

A stream of memes and jokes flooded social media after a stunning 2-0 defeat to South Korea condemned Die Mannschaft to their earliest exit in 80 years.

"Don't mention the VAR," was a common refrain, while Brazilian media gleefully took their revenge for Brazil's 7-1 humiliation by Germany at the last World Cup in 2014.

"AHAHAHAHAHAHAHAHAHA..." read a tweet from Fox Sports Brasil that ran to 272 characters.

In dramatic scenes in Kazan, Kim Young-gwon's stoppage-time opener was ruled legitimate after intervention from the Video Assistant Referee, before Son Heung-min added the second goal minutes later.

"Germany's fastest exit from Russia since 1943," posted one user, while another tweeted a picture of Germany towels reserving all the seats on an empty plane.

Mexico fans were particularly delighted after South Korea's last-gasp win allowed them to qualify for the last 16 behind Group F winners Sweden -- while Germany finished rock bottom.

Aeromexico offered a 20 percent discount on flights to South Korea, tweeting an image of a plane with doctored "AeroCorea" livery and the slogan, "We love you Korea!"
